Marine Grade Ply Research

- Marine grade ply has a very high tensile strength due to the multiple layers it is made up of.
- The hardness of this material is very high, it is not soft.
- Marine grade ply has a very low ductility, it is very strong & rigid.
- It would take a lot of pressure to make marine grade ply to collapse due to it's high shear strength.

Flax Research

- The tensile strength for flax is rougly medium, it can be broken more easily depending on how thick it is.
- The hardness for flax is around medium, it is not too hard or too soft
- Flax has a very high ductility, it is not just a straight solid material.
- Shear strength for flax is medium, similar to tensile strength.

Epoxy Resin Research

- The tensile strength of epoxy resin is extremely high, it can resist an immense amount of pressure before it reaches breaking point.
- The hardness of epoxy resin is naturally very high but it can be modified to be soft.
- When epoxy resin has been applied to a material it has a very low ductility, if it didn't it wouldn't be a very good adhesive.
- Shear strength for epoxy resin is very high, epoxy resin won't collapse on itself.
